Fettuccine Alfredo
12 oz. fettuccine
1/2 cup grated parmesan cheese
2/3 cup sour cream or light cream
1/4 lb. sweet butter
1 egg yolk
Cook noodles per package directions.
Beat egg yolk; add to cream.
Melt butter.
Place drained noodles on a warm platter. Pour egg cream mixture, butter and half the cheese over noodles.
Toss until well blended.
Add remaining cheese; toss again.
Serve with additional grated cheese.
Excellent with ham.
 
Ham Baked with Mustard
Ham slices, 1” thick
4 Tbsp. brown sugar
2 Tbsp. flour,
2 tsp. dry mustard,
Freshen ham by parboiling, if necessary. Place in baking pan, add small amount water to prevent sticking.
Cover each slice with mixture of sugar, flour and dry mustard.
Cook on stove top until tender.
 
Glorified Gingerbread
2 cups flour
1 cup sugar
1 tsp. cinnamon
1/2 tsp. ginger
1/4 tsp. salt
1/2 cup shortening
1 egg
1/3 cup molasses
1 cup sour milk
1 tsp. baking soda
Sift together flour, sugar, cinnamon, ginger and salt; add shortening. Mix as for pie crust. Take out 1/2 cup of the mixture and reserve for later.
To the remainder, add: 1 beaten egg, 1/3 cup molasses and 1 cup sour milk in which 1 tsp. soda has been dissolved.
Stir lightly – as for muffin batter.
Place in shallow 8”x8” baking pan.
Cover with reserved crumb mixture.
Bake 45 min. at 350º.
